Q: Is 310,020,202 a Prime Number?
A: No, 310,020,202 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 310020202 can be evenly divided by 1 2 10,937 14,173 21,874 28,346 155,010,101 and 310,020,202, with no remainder.
Since 310,020,202 cannot be divided by just 1 and 310,020,202, it is not a prime number.
